Handicap Shower Installation in Framingham, MA
Handicap shower installation services focus on creating accessible and functional shower spaces designed to accommodate individuals with mobility challenges. These projects typically involve installing walk-in or curbless showers, adding grab bars, installing seating options, and ensuring proper slip-resistant flooring. Property owners often seek these modifications to improve safety, independence, and comfort in their bathrooms, whether for aging in place, disability accommodations, or to assist family members with limited mobility.
Before requesting handicap shower installation, property owners should consider the specific needs of the user, the existing bathroom layout, and any necessary accessibility features. It’s important to evaluate the space available for modifications, understand the preferred shower style, and identify any additional safety elements like handrails or non-slip surfaces. Clear communication about these requirements helps ensure the installation meets safety standards and personal preferences, resulting in a functional, accessible bathroom space.

Handicap Shower Installation Questions
What is a handicap shower installation? It involves modifying or installing a shower to improve accessibility, such as adding grab bars, low thresholds, or seating options for easier use.
What types of modifications are common in handicap showers? Common modifications include installing grab bars, slip-resistant flooring, adjustable shower heads, and seating to enhance safety and comfort.
Who should consider a handicap shower upgrade? Property owners seeking easier and safer shower access for individuals with mobility challenges or those planning for aging-in-place may find these upgrades beneficial.
What should property owners know before installation? It’s important to plan for space requirements, ensure proper clearance, and select features that meet specific accessibility needs for a safe and functional shower.
